Here's the full Who, What, Where, When, Why and How, a bit out of order ...
We miss you Jim!On December 25, 2007, Jim, the creator of this page passed away. He will be missed deeply by family, friends, and internet community. Jim's obituary. We leave these pages so that we can remind ourselves of all the good Jim as done. Java ranch honoring Jim. What SurfScranton is the leading free resource for the online community in the Scranton, Pennsylvania, area. Our mission makes up two sides of the same coin: First, we help you find anything you need in the area. Second, we help businesses, churches, temples, organizations and individuals promote themselves to the online world. And we try to have some fun in the process. All 1436 links are listed here free of charge. Some search engines and link sites charge for listings, only list web sites they built themselves, or try to make other sites buy choice spots. But we try to be as fair and democratic as possible with all the links we can find organized by category and alphabetical order. Oh, and speaking of categories ... no category on the menu will ever be empty. We get the sites first, then make up the categories, never the other way around! How We put the list together by spending countless hours scouring every search engine we could find for anything related to Scranton and surrounding towns. We've gotten some great suggestions from our viewers, too. Please send us more! After the first 50 sites, we thought we had probably found all the good stuff. After the first 100 we were sure. From there on, we were just amazed. Now with over 700 sites, we hope you are, too. The Geek Fun page has more details on how we manage all the links. Where Well, Scranton, of course. Actually I live in Clarks Summit, and the site is hosted goodness-knows-where on the web, but you know what I mean. When SurfScranton first appeared on a free web server in the summer of 1999. Now it's on its second commercial service provider. It's still growing and changing. This new page layout (1-1-2000) is a big example of how things can change. Why This all started out for two reasons. First, the WebMaster needed the web practice and it was a better topic than pictures of his cat. Second, we were interested in finding out more about the area. Now that it's up, SurfScranton has a whole new reason to live. We believe it will be a real value to the community. Visitors or residents past, present and future can find interesting things to see and do, businesses, churches and stores. Businesses can make themselves known to the population. Who SurfScranton was conceived, researched, designed and constructed by your faithful servant, the WebMaster. I use the royal "we" a lot of places because I had help, and I have friends and colleagues I can bring in to help others. I'm a computer professional with 21 years with one of those billion dollar companies that almost every kid and adult in America could identify in a second. I've been in on every leading edge technology you can think of, now including building complex, transactional web sites, and now I'm called a Software Architect. I don't splash my name and address around the site to spare my family any phone calls that they won't understand. But if you need the personal touch, e-mail me at SurfScranton and I'll get back to you. |
